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57909663 331432861 99806798462 5789 9835
67225984 553298178
67225984 553298178
40588 43494 86910460
All about undefined
Interested in learning more?
67225984 553298178
40588 43494 86910460
See more
5585958985 03
587468 318 52463888
See more
7461 95 334608871
27805598442 039 82
See more